#ifndef jit_UnreachableCodeElimination_h
#define jit_UnreachableCodeElimination_h
#include "MIR.h"
#include "MIRGraph.h"
namespace js {
namespace jit {
class MIRGraph;
class UnreachableCodeElimination
{
typedef Vector<MBasicBlock *, 16, SystemAllocPolicy> BlockList;
MIRGenerator *mir_;
MIRGraph &graph_;
uint32_t marked_;
bool redundantPhis_;
bool rerunAliasAnalysis_;
bool prunePointlessBranchesAndMarkReachableBlocks();
void checkDependencyAndRemoveUsesFromUnmarkedBlocks(MDefinition *instr);
bool removeUnmarkedBlocksAndClearDominators();
bool removeUnmarkedBlocksAndCleanup();
bool enqueue(MBasicBlock *block, BlockList &list);
MBasicBlock *optimizableSuccessor(MBasicBlock *block);
public:
UnreachableCodeElimination(MIRGenerator *mir, MIRGraph &graph)
: mir_(mir),
graph_(graph),
marked_(0),
redundantPhis_(false),
rerunAliasAnalysis_(false)
{}
// Walks the graph and discovers what is reachable. Removes everything else.
bool analyze();
// Removes any blocks that are not marked. Assumes that these blocks are not
// reachable. The parameter |marked| should be the number of blocks that
// are marked.
bool removeUnmarkedBlocks(size_t marked);
};
} /* namespace jit */
} /* namespace js */
#endif /* jit_UnreachableCodeElimination_h */
